from evaluation.evaluation import text_search, vector_search, rrf, evaluate

def hybrid_search(query,  k=60):
    text_results = text_search(query, text_index, num_results=10)
    vector_results = vector_search(query, embedder, index, num_results=10)

    return rrf([text_results, vector_results], k=k)
evaluate(ground_truth, hybrid_search)
  0%|          | 0/13874 [00:00<?, ?it/s]





{'hit_rate': 0.6015568689635289, 'mrr': 0.4079116813223703}
